8a861a7 verified | """SoftChart — custom Gradio Server app for Hugging Face Spaces. | |
| Generate a Taiko no Tatsujin chart from any audio file, using the full system: | |
| - SoftChartGenerator (main model, plan-conditioned) | |
| - SoftChartPlanner (auto song-level planning) | |
| - SoftChartBeat (beat/downbeat for barline anchoring) | |
| All models load from the Hub via from_pretrained. MIT licensed. | |
| """ | |

| # Density bucket (width 0.75 notes/sec) requested per course. Measured on all | |
| # 1 155 songs of JacobLinCool/taiko-1000-parsed: median chart-span note rate is | |
| # 1.33 / 2.01 / 3.40 / 5.27 / 6.60 notes per second for easy / normal / hard / | |
| # oni / ura, which buckets to 1 / 2 / 4 / 7 / 8. The first four reproduce the | |
| # values this app already shipped; ura extends the same measurement and agrees | |
| # with the map the rest of the repo uses (scripts/infer.py, closed_loop.py, | |
| # eval_slot.py, gen_samples.py). | |
| COURSE_DENS = {"easy": 1, "normal": 2, "hard": 4, "oni": 7, "ura": 8} | |
| # TJA `COURSE:` header literals, measured rather than assumed. Of the 1 155 | |
| # songs in the corpus, 229 carry an ura chart, and every one writes its header | |
| # as `Edit` (223) or the numeric `4` (6); the string "Ura" never appears -- it | |
| # is the dataset's normalized course NAME. `str(course).capitalize()`, which | |
| # both TJA writers use, would emit the invalid `COURSE:Ura`. | |
| # softchart/tja.py is vendored library code this app does not own, so the slot | |
| # writer's header is normalized here instead. For the four courses that shipped | |
| # before, this map reproduces the writers' output exactly, so normalization is | |
| # a no-op on them (asserted in scripts/test_app_wiring.py). | |
| TJA_COURSE_HEADER = {"easy": "Easy", "normal": "Normal", "hard": "Hard", | |
| "oni": "Oni", "ura": "Edit"} | |
| # Course ids the shipped planner was TRAINED on. scripts/train_planner.py builds | |
| # its dataset with courses=("easy","normal","hard","oni") and has no other call | |
| # site, so embedding row 4 (ura) only ever received weight decay. Probing the | |
| # published checkpoint confirms it: mean predicted density bucket per course id | |
| # is 0.573 / 1.126 / 2.274 / 3.789 for the trained ids -- monotone, as expected | |
| # -- and 1.471 for id 4, i.e. it would ask for a SPARSER plan for ura than for | |
| # oni, when ura is the densest course in the corpus. Row 4 is therefore not used. | |
| PLANNER_COURSE_ID = {"easy": 0, "normal": 1, "hard": 2, "oni": 3} | |
| # Courses the planner cannot answer for, and the trained course substituted for | |
| # them. Oni is ura's direct sibling and the highest trained density contour. | |
| # The substitution is reported to the user, never applied silently. | |
| PLANNER_COURSE_FALLBACK = {"ura": "oni"} | |
